To compare data of different samples, a
ModifierSet can be used. To select the data
alongside the transcripts and their positions a
GRanges or a
GRangesList needs to be provided.
In case of a GRanges object, the parent column must match the
transcript names as defined by the out put of ranges(x), whereas in
case of a GRangesList the element names must match the transcript
names.

compareByCoord returns a
DataFrame and
plotCompareByCoord returns a ggplot object, which can be
modified further. The DataFrame contains columns per sample as well
as the columns names, positions and mod incorporated
from the coord input. If coord contains a column
Activity this is included in the results as well.
